WebMay 30, 2024 · The nation's freight train network is vital to moving a variety of commodities including fuel, food, and consumer goods. While railroads generally transport these goods safely, concerns have been raised about the safety of operating longer trains, some of which are nearly 3 miles long. The Federal Railroad Administration (FRA) is studying the ...
